Job Description

CCTV jobs in Zambia involve roles such as installation technicians, surveillance analysts, and maintenance specialists, all crucial for enhancing security systems across various sectors. Technicians typically engage in setting up hardware, ensuring cameras are strategically positioned to cover vulnerable areas. Surveillance analysts monitor footage to identify suspicious activities and gather evidence for investigations, contributing to overall safety in communities. Maintenance specialists are responsible for troubleshooting and repairing equipment to ensure continuous operation of surveillance systems, making these positions vital in supporting Zambia's growing security demands.

Salary and Perks Expected

CCTV jobs in Zambia typically offer competitive salaries that range from $500 to $1,500 per month, depending on experience and specific roles. Many employers provide additional perks, such as health insurance, transportation allowances, and opportunities for professional development. As the demand for security personnel increases, working in this field can lead to valuable career advancement opportunities. Career Advantage and Weakness

CCTV jobs in Zambia offer a significant career advantage due to the increasing demand for security solutions across various sectors, including retail, banking, and residential areas. These roles often provide opportunities for advancement, exposure to advanced technology, and skills development in surveillance systems and security management. One potential weakness to consider is the competitive job market, which may require you to possess specialized certifications or experience to stand out among applicants. Additionally, working in this field may involve irregular hours and varying levels of personal risk, depending on the assignment location.

List of Ideal City

Lusaka, the capital city of Zambia, offers numerous opportunities in the CCTV industry due to its growing focus on security and surveillance technology. Ndola, known for its industrial base, also presents job prospects in managing and installing CCTV systems in various sectors. Kitwe, with its vibrant mining and commercial activities, banks on enhanced security measures, thereby creating demand for CCTV professionals.
